Q: Is 41,232 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 41,232 is not a prime number.

Why is 41,232 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 41232 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 4 6 8 12 16 24 48 859 1,718 2,577 3,436 5,154 6,872 10,308 13,744 20,616 and 41,232, with no remainder.

Since 41,232 cannot be divided by just 1 and 41,232, it is not a prime number.
